I wasn't sure what to expect but I felt that this accomodation over delivered. It's not as boutique as some and is, due to it's location, in less of a "character " area however it's also opposite there Ferry which makes it easy to deposit your bags. We arrived before checkin time and there was definitely no early checking however we were welcomed and 'pre checked" so that we could go out and enjoy the town. We stayed 2 nights and we could have easily stayed three. If you are an active tourist there is plenty to do on this wee island. Our room had great air con; comfortable futon style beds and a good massage chair. When you "really" check in there are pyjamas and slippers to choose from and you are welcome to wear these within the facility. I enjoyed doing this..no everyone does. The hotel has a lovely public bath. Evening meals are buffet - but certainly not low quality. We prefer to eat later and not was sometimes a challenge to be able to secure a later reservation. On our second night we were serviced a "special" meal given that we had reserved for 2 nights. We appreciated this attention to detail. There is a nice lounge for guests with tea and coffee and a bar /small kitchen for snacks and drinks. As non Japanese we felt that there was enough information what allowed us to understand how to behave a(so as not to offend) and to enjoy ourselves and the facility. This isn't a full "Ryokan" experience but it was a good "in between" opportunity for us. I certainly would recommend this as an option for anyone wanting a night or more in Miyajima.

This is my second stay at the Miyajima Villa and this time we had my 2 year old son with us. We stayed in a triple bed room with a view of the harbour which my son loved, he liked watching the boats and cars from the windows. The beds were mattresses on a single raised platform which was great as it was the only hotel we stayed in where we didn't have to worry about our son rolling off the bed on to the floor in the night. The room was clean and had a relaxed feel. At dinner we were provided with a baby chair and cutlery for our son which was good and the staff were very friendly, helpful and patient with him. The evening buffet was the same both nights but on our second night we were also served a fantastic pasta as well as a beef dish for main. Both were delicious but the beef was fantastic. The hotel is opposite the ferry terminal and also has easy access to the main part of miyajima and tori gate.

We had a great time in this hotel, ideally located just outside the Miyajima ferry. The staff is friendly, young, always available. The rooms are very well appointed. The main meals are included (breakfast and dinner) and the cuisine is truly excellent and varied. In addition, it is the only hotel in all the ones we stayed in Japan that allows tattooed travelers to benefit from onsen, a much appreciated open-mindedness. We stayed there for 3 nights because, from there, it is easy to get to Hiroshima, which allows the rest of the time to appreciate this corner of extraordinary nature that is the sacred island of Miyajima, which turns out to be very calm in the evening as soon as the daytime tourists have left.
